Description

Boost Business Lancashire is the County's Business Growth Hub, a local public/private sector partnership led by the Lancashire Enterprise Partnership and Lancashire County Council, providing businesses access to a range of advice and funding programmes. Following an ERDF tender process Growth Lancashire won the contract to deliver the Growth Hub Gateway Service to 31st December 2018.

One of the four elements of the Gateway Service contract is to deliver business support in the form of an Information, Diagnostic and Brokerage (IDB) service to ERDF eligible businesses. Other elements of Growth Lancashire's contract consist of a Business Helpline Service, a Client Record and Tracking system, and a Growth Voucher programme.
This opportunity is for the delivery of the IDB service
